Computer Science
The department of Computer Science offers a Bachelor of Science in Computer Science (BSCS) as well as a Bachelor of Arts (BA) in computer science. One of the strengths of the computer science program is the balance between theory and practice. Students are well versed in theory and programming while at the same time being exposed to real world situations thereby gaining valuable experience. Available courses include:
Students graduating with a BSCS in Computer Science are schooled in upper-level computer science topics with a solid foundation in mathematics and the sciences. Within the BSCS degree, students select a general computer science or software engineering track. The software engineering track emphasizes the methods used to produce and maintain high-quality software in a systematic, controlled and efficient manner. Students who are acquiring their BA in computer science acquire a traditional liberal arts education with a solid set of core computer science courses.

Bachelor of Arts in Great Texts of the Western Tradition
The Great Texts major is one of two undergraduate majors within the Baylor University Honors College, but it is not required that you be part of Honors to major in Great Texts. The coursework includes the study of influential written works from a variety of cultures throughout the ages. Available courses include:
The Great Texts program offers an integrated humanities education that crosses the customary academic divisions between what we know, what we love and how we live together. These studies are intensely practical because questions in real life often concern the connections between knowledge, ethical discernment and imaginative enjoyment. Many graduates pursue graduate, law and medical school. Graduates can also expect to find career opportunities in international business or at academic institutions.

Environmental Health Science
Environmental Health Science studies the relationship between the environment and human health. This includes preventing illness by identifying and assessing hazardous agents, environmental sources and limiting exposures to chemical, physical and biological agents in air, water, soil, food and other environments that may impact human health. Environmental health professionals work to ensure safe water, food, air quality and workplace conditions, mitigate the impact of disasters and investigate and help control disease outbreaks. Psychology
Psychology is the study of mental processes and behavior. As psychology majors (designated as a pre-major), students learn about many diverse concepts including perception, cognition, emotion and personality. Other concepts include behavior, interpersonal relationships and the individual and collective unconscious. Coursework involves the application of learned concepts to spheres of human activity. Available courses include:
The Psychology major is available either as a Bachelor of Arts degree or as a Bachelor of Science degree. The Bachelor of Arts degree plan emphasizes the study of humanities in Psychology, while the Bachelor of Science degree plan has a greater emphasis in science and mathematics.
